S 266
A.D. '761' altered to '781'. Æthelberht, king of Wessex and Kent, to Deora, bishop of Rochester; grant of land at Rochester. Latin with English bounds
Archive:
Rochester
MSS:
1. London, British Library, Cotton Charters vi. 4 (BM Facs., iv. 5)
2. Maidstone, Kent Archives Office, DRc/R1 (Textus Roffensis), ff. 130v-131r (s. xii 1; facsimile)
Printed:
Hearne, Textus Roffensis, pp. 85-6; Thorpe, Reg. Roff., p. 17; K, 144; Mon. Angl. (rev. edn), i. 167 (no. 31); B, 242, ex Hearne, K and MS 1; Earle, pp. 332-3; Campbell, Rochester, no. 11
Comments:
BM Facs., iv, p. 7, MS 1 probably 11th-century; Wallenberg, KPN, pp. 3, 59; Levison 1946, p. 224 n., perhaps confusion between charter of 781 (? of Egbert II of Kent) and one of Æthelberht of Wessex (860 x 865); Ward 1949, p. 39; Campbell, Rochester, pp. xiv, xxiii, MS 1 may be s. ix; elements from a Kentish charter of 781 may have been fused with a charter of Æthelberht of Wessex; Lowe 2001, Appendix II.24
